The Role of Road Marking in Smart Cities

In smart cities, infrastructure is not just functional—it is responsive. Roads equipped with sensor-based traffic systems, IoT-enabled signals, and automated vehicles demand a higher level of precision and performance from their surface markings. Road marking paint, once considered a simple utility, is now a critical tool in guiding autonomous vehicles, enhancing pedestrian safety, and optimizing traffic flow.

Well-applied and durable thermoplastic road marking paint, paired with reflective glass beads, ensures maximum visibility under varied weather and lighting conditions. This visual clarity is not just beneficial—it is vital. Whether it’s a self-driving car interpreting its lane or a pedestrian navigating a busy crosswalk at night, the quality of road markings can mean the difference between safety and risk.

Thermoplastic vs. Water-Based Paints: Meeting Global Standards

Thermoplastic Road Marking Paint

  • Durability: Highly resistant to wear and tear, ideal for high-traffic zones.
  • Drying Time: Quick-setting, reducing road downtime during application.
  • Visibility: Superior reflectivity, especially when glass beads are added, ensuring night-time visibility.
  • Environmental Impact: Contains more VOCs compared to water-based options.
  • Best Used For: Highways, airports, major intersections — where long-lasting markings are crucial.
  • Customization: Can be tailored for local climate conditions, traffic volumes, and safety standards.

Water-Based Road Marking Paint

  • Durability: Adequate for moderate traffic, though may require reapplication more often.
  • Drying Time: Moderate; quicker in warmer conditions.
  • Visibility: Good visibility, with optional additives to enhance reflectivity.
  • Environmental Impact: Low VOCs, making it suitable for eco-conscious projects.
  • Best Used For: Urban roads, residential areas, schools, and sustainability-focused developments.
  • Customization: Easily adjusted to meet regional regulations and environmental goals.

Glass Beads: The Silent Guardians of Night-Time Safety

While road paint forms the base, it is the glass beads embedded within the markings that ensure night-time visibility. These reflective glass beads act like miniature mirrors, returning light from headlights directly back to drivers and enhancing road safety during low-light conditions.

This seemingly small component plays a monumental role in reducing accidents, guiding traffic, and supporting visual navigation in smart transportation systems. Manufacturers that supply high-performance glass beads for road markings are integral to city planning departments aiming to meet modern safety benchmarks. The use of double-drop or intermix beads, and adherence to international standards like BS6088 or AASHTO M247, reflects a commitment to quality and public safety.

Global Supply Trends and Innovations in Road Marking Materials

The global demand for road marking paints and glass beads is being driven not just by infrastructure expansion but by innovation. Manufacturers are now incorporating intelligent pigments that interact with temperature, moisture, or UV levels to adapt their reflectivity or color. Additionally, anti-skid formulations and fast-drying coatings are improving road safety, particularly in high-risk zones like curves and intersections.

From Europe to Southeast Asia, governments are increasing investment in smart road technologies. This is opening new markets for road paint manufacturers who can offer fast delivery, regulatory compliance, and customized solutions.

Another key trend is localization of production. With smart cities emerging in diverse climates—from the humid streets of Mumbai to the icy highways of Scandinavia—formulations must adapt to local weather conditions while maintaining performance. International suppliers who provide region-specific solutions will lead the future of global road marking paint supply.
